Phone number ☎️ 02080764496 👆 is reported as a persistent scam call claiming to be from major UK mobile providers like EE, O2, and Three. Callers often falsely assert account issues or offer discounts, then request personal information such as email addresses under the guise of verification. Many recipients note inconsistencies, such as being contacted by the wrong provider or suspicious follow-up calls. Users are advised to remain cautious, avoid sharing personal details, and block the number. Genuine providers typically do not request sensitive information unsolicited, so these calls should be treated as fraudulent and ignored.

About 02 Numbers
The indicated num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are frequently used by homes and businesses. Sometimes referred to as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. Numerous service providers offer call packages that allow free calls during specified times. Call costs from mobile phones are reliant on the chosen calling plan, with a number of plans including these numbers in their free call packages.
